Technical Abstract: Transitioning from a high school student into a professional career requires an array of skills that one will collectively develop over the years. During this process, it is important to develop the necessary skills that will help with the transition and help you stand out from the crowd. Here I discuss how I transitioned from a high school to a postdoctoral research chemist and how the skills I acquired over the years prepared me for the steps I took in my journey.
